XmListGetMatchPos(3X)
OSF/Motif
NAME
XmListGetMatchPos - A List function that returns all instances of an item
in the list
SYNOPSIS
#include <Xm/List.h>
Boolean XmListGetMatchPos (widget, item, position_list, position_count)
Widget widget;
XmString item;
int **position_list;
int *position_count;
DESCRIPTION
XmListGetMatchPos is a Boolean function that returns an array of positions
where a specified item is found in a List.
widget
Specifies the ID of the List widget.
item
Specifies the item to search for.
position_list
Returns an array of positions at which the item occurs in the List. The
position of the first item in the list is 1; the position of the second
item is 2; and so on. When the return value is TRUE, XmListGetMatchPos
allocates memory for this array. The caller is responsible for freeing
this memory.
position_count
Returns the number of elements in the position_list.
For a complete definition of List and its associated resources, see
XmList(3X).
RETURN VALUE
Returns TRUE if the specified item is present in the list, and FALSE if it
is not.
